SSS – Social Security System – Purpose, Functions, and Responsibilities

sss philippines

The Social Security System (SSS) is a government agency in the Philippines that offers social insurance programs to Filipinos. The SSS provides protection against various contingencies such as old age, disability, death, and unemployment. DSWD AMOR Village – Accelerating Minors’ Opportunity for Recovery

dswd amor village accelerating minors opportunity for recovery

The DSWD AMOR Village is a government-run shelter for abused, neglected, and abandoned children overseen by the Department of Social Welfare and Development (DSWD). AMOR is an acronym and stands for Accelerating Minors’ Opportunity for Recovery.
